Browse Average Salary Ranges for Customer Services Jobs

What are the average salary ranges for jobs in the Customer Services? There are 79 jobs in Customer Services category. Average salaries can vary and range from $34,092 to $49,903. Salary ranges can differ significantly depending on the job, industry, location, required experience, specific skills, education, and other factors...Salaries listed below are U.S. national average data from July 31, 2026.

Alternate Job Titles: Card Service Representative | Card Customer Support Representative | Card Services Associate

Provides customer service for an organization's credit and debit card programs. Processes credit and debit card applications and ensures accurate and complete submissions. Responds to customer inquiries regarding statements, billing disputes, and application status. Researches and documents fraudulent transactions and issues replacement cards. Alternate Job Titles: Personal Banking Representative | Customer Sales and Service Representative | Personal Banker I

Responsible for providing in-branch services to customers. Identifies customer needs and uses current knowledge of bank products and services to explain, promote, and cross-sell products and services. Processes basic branch service transactions and refers customers to the right resource to facilitate other banking requests. Alternate Job Titles: Network Service Representative I | Telecommunication Service Representative - Entry

Identifies and resolves customer issues regarding service or billing. Addresses issues of telecommunication or cable service interruption, billing inquiries, and billing discrepancies. May be responsible for promoting products or services.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Typically requires 0-2 years of related experience.
